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
53295258433 59015 8723976 664646 582
327878417 62361
327878417 62361
70626 842 3635 1320
All about undefined
Interested in learning more?
327878417 62361
70626 842 3635 1320
See more
85553022259 51683 233569853
496100230 303 450038202
See more
346 025320 46
8112095 51126 988953967 24868 3863112
See more